Step-by-step explanation:
If a population is decreasing by 8% we can multiply the population by 92% (1-.08)
which means we have the following equation
population=15000(.92)ⁿ
where n is the number of years
we want to know when the population will be 10,000 so we write
10,000=15,000(.92)ⁿ
.66667=.92ⁿ
a rule we have is

which means that

compute this and get
4.867
round this up to 5
Answer:
7.5 weeks
Step-by-step explanation:
If you want to find out how long it take for the plant to reach a foot you set up the equation like so:
12=1.2w+3
and solve from there.
12=1.2w+3 Subrtact 3 from both sides
9=1.2w Divide by 1.2 to isolate w
7.5=w Answer is 7.5 weeks
